Meaning of Kinju
The meaning of Kinju presents an interesting linguistic puzzle. Despite thorough research across Sanskrit, Hindi, and regional Indian languages, no definitive etymological source has been identified. The name doesn’t appear in classical texts or established naming dictionaries. Some naming websites suggest meanings like ‘precious’ or ‘jewel,’ possibly drawing from phonetic similarities to words in various Indian languages, but these connections remain unverified. What makes Kinju particularly fascinating is its emergence as a modern name creation, reflecting contemporary naming trends where sound and aesthetic appeal sometimes take precedence over traditional meanings. This phenomenon isn’t uncommon in today’s globalized naming landscape, where parents often prioritize uniqueness and phonetic beauty.

Origin & Cultural Significance
Kinju appears to be a modern Indian name without clear historical roots in ancient naming traditions. Its emergence likely reflects 21st-century naming trends where parents create or adapt names for their melodic qualities and distinctive sound. The name has gained some popularity in Hindu communities, particularly in urban areas where traditional naming conventions are sometimes blended with contemporary preferences. While not tied to specific mythological figures or historical texts, Kinju represents the evolving nature of Indian naming practices, where innovation and personal expression play increasingly important roles. Its usage suggests a departure from strictly meaning-based names toward those that embody aesthetic and emotional qualities valued by modern parents.
